WebSulfur is a chemical element with an atomic number of 16 and an atomic symbol of S. At room temperature it is a yellow crystalline solid. Even though it is insoluble in water, it is one of the most versatile elements at forming compounds. Sulfur reacts and forms compounds with all elements except gold, iodine, iridium, nitrogen, platinum ... WebSulfur is present in all living tissues. WebSulfur is an essential macronutrient which can be found in nearly all human proteins, the building blocks of the body’s tissues and organs. This mineral element makes up 0.3% of the body weight, the same as potassium. Calcium and phosphorus are the only other minerals that are yet more abundant in human body.
